How to Make Light Chicken Fried Steak

  1. In a shallow dish, whisk together 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our and 1/2 teaspoon black pepper.
  2. Place chicken breasts between two sheets of plastic wrap. Using a meat mallet, gently pound each chicken breast to 1/4 inch thickness.
  3. Lightly spray a large skillet with nonstick cooking spray. Heat over medium heat.
  4. Add chicken breasts to the skillet and cook for 3-4 minutes per side, until golden brown.
  5. Remove chicken from skillet and set aside. If necessary, drain off any excess grease.
  6. Add 1 cup of water and 1 beef bouillon cube (or 1 teaspoon beef bouillon granules) to the skillet. Bring to a boil.
  7. Re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er for 75 minutes, or until chicken is very tender.
  8. Remove chicken from the skillet and keep warm.
  9. In a medium bowl, gradually whisk 1/2 cup skim milk into 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our until smooth.
  10. Pour the milk mixture into the skillet with the pan juices.
  11. Cook over medium heat, stirring constantly, until the sauce thickens and bubbles. Cook for 1 additional minute.
  12. Serve the light chicken fried steak over mashed potatoes, generously drizzled with the creamy gravy.
